Abstract

DISPOSITIVO PARA AJUSTAR LA TEMPORIZACION DE LAS VALVULAS DE UN MOTOR DE COMBUSTION INTERNA. COMPRENDE UN MIEMBRO GIRATORIO (21) DESTINADO A SER ACCIONADO EN ROTACION DESDE, POR EJEMPLO, UN CIGUVEÑAL DE UN MOTOR DE PISTON, EN RELACION ANGULAR FIJA CON EL, OTRO MIEMBRO (22) CONECTABLE MEDIANTE UN TORNILLO (34) Y UNA CLAVIJA (36) PARA ACCIONAR UN ARBOL DE LEVAS DE ADMISION (26) DEL MOTOR EN RELACION ANGULAR FIJA CON EL, Y MEDIOS DE TRANSMISION DE ACCIONAMIENTO (92, 93, 20) CONECTADOS PARA ACCIONAR A DICHO OTRO MIEMBRO (22) A ROTACION A PARTIR DE DICHO MIEMBRO GIRATORIO (21). EL CONTROL ES EFECTUADO AJUSTANDO EL VOLUMEN DE <BLOQUEO> DE ACEITE EN LA CAVIDAD (56).
